\displaystyle 36\text{ kmph }=\frac{\text{36}\times \text{1000}}{60\times 60}=10\text{ m}{{\text{s}}^{\text{-1}}}

\displaystyle \text{Momentum }= \displaystyle 1200 \times 10 = 12000 \text{ Ns}
